Handover for the Fennelgate analytics warehouse: the measurements table is partitioned by month, and a scheduled job creates next month's partition on the 25th. If that job fails, inserts land in the default partition and queries slow down badly, so check it after any deploy. Dropping old partitions requires sign-off from data retention. Partition naming follows the measurements_yyyymm convention; do not create them by hand without reading the procedure first. The full partition maintenance guide is on the internal page below.

operations page: https://jenkins.zemvarcloud.local/job/merge_requests/repo/build/73930b4b30f0a8ed

Heads up for the sync: the Cartwheel checkout flow load test tripped the latency alert again last night. We pushed 4x normal traffic through the Brindlewood staging cluster and p95 climbed past 2.4s around the payment-confirm step. Nothing's on fire in prod, but the headroom is thinner than we thought before the Lanternfest promo. Marit is re-running with the tuned connection pool tonight. Full graphs and the test config are on the internal dashboard.

wiki page, fahaf-yagag: https://confluence.qorvellabs.internal/pages/display/pages/display

Checklist item 7: Verify bloom filter warm-up for the Tindervale KV tier before cutover. Confirm that the Larkspur filter is rebuilt from the latest snapshot, that the target false-positive rate is at or below 1%, and that miss-path latency stays under 3ms at p99 during the canary window. Odette owns sign-off; do not proceed until her dashboard shows green. Record results against the build noted below.

pipeline stamp: htk31_f769b577b3028a4e9958e5bb8d1259a